Fair Light Cottage Accommodation was featured as one of the 20 best holiday houses in Australia - VOGUE Entertaining and Travel January 2007. Luxury bedrooms, extensive comfortable living areas, country kitchen and exquisite antique furniture are sure to delight.
This enchanting shipwright cottage and is exclusively yours as long as you choose to stay. Set on 5 acres with commanding views of the bay and mountains surrounding Cygnet, you will enjoy the luxury of log fires, local wine, views across the water from all rooms.
Wander in the garden and pick your own fruits and strawberries in season, stroll to the village of Cygnet to restaurants or galleries or take a short drive to Hobart, the Hartz Mountains, the Huon or Bruny Island. Come back each day to cosy log fires. Close by are several award winning restaurants and wineries.
A hamper of Tasmanian wine, foods and chocolates awaits you.
